<FONT face=Arial size=3>Anywayz...I have a 98 Eclipse Spyder GST and I've just installed the Injen Intake(with after market BOV version) and HKS SSQV Blowoff Valve...</FONT></P>


<FONT face=Arial size=3>My 'Check Engine' light was up and I went to the dealer and turn it off...it was the emission problem by the error code...nothing was wrong...</FONT></P>


<FONT face=Arial size=3>And few days later, which is today, 'Check Engine' light is up again!!!</FONT></P>


<FONT face=Arial size=3>I'm gussing since HKS SSQV Blowoff Valve doesn't have recirculation to intake, rich signals are sending to the stock air sensor and cause the problem...</FONT></P>


<FONT face=Arial size=3>Do you guys know how to avoid this problem?</FONT></P>


<FONT face=Arial size=3>I don't wanna get the recirculation kit because I wanna keep this sound...</FONT></P>

venting the blow off valve to the atmosphere will actually cause a loss of performance, as your missing the additional spooling you will get when the boost is dumped back upstream of the impeller.</P>
